Do Not Forget to Switch Off Utilities
In case of a catastrophe, specifically if you reside in a flood-prone location, it would certainly be recommended to switch off the main electric circuit. This cuts off power to your entire house, stopping electrical shocks when water is available in as it is a conductor. Moreover, do not forget to shut off the major water line valve. When floodwaters are high, furniture will certainly walk around as well as create damage. Having the major shutoff turned off protects against more damages.

Do Take Notice Of Small Leakages
A ruptured pipe doesn't occur over night. You might discover bubbling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water streaks, water spots, or leaking audios behind the wall surfaces. Have your plumbing repaired before it results in enormous damages.
Do Not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ipe
Keeping your presence of mind is crucial in a time of situation. Stressing will just worsen the problem because it will stifle you from acting fast. When it involves water damages, timing is crucial. The longer you wait, the even more damage you can expect. Thus, if a pipeline bursts in your house, instantly shut off your main water shutoff to cut off the resource. After that unplug all electric outlets in the area or turn off the breaker for that part of your house. Call a trustworthy water damage reconstruction professional for help.

Some Do's & Don't When Dealing with a Water Damage
DO:
Make sure the water source has been eliminated. Contact a plumber if needed. Turn off circuit breakers supplying electricity to wet areas and unplug any electronics that are on wet carpet or surfaces Remove small furniture items Remove as much excess water as possible by mopping or blotting; Use WHITE towels to blot wet carpeting Wipe water from wooden furniture after removing anything on it Remove and prop up wet upholstery cushions for even drying (check for any bleeding) Pin up curtains or furniture skirts if needed Place aluminum foil, saucers or wood blocks between furniture legs and wet carpet Turn on air conditioning for maximum drying in winter and open windows in the summer Open any drawers and cabinets affected for complete drying but do not force them open Remove any valuable art objects or paintings to a safe, dry place Open any suitcases or luggage that may have been affected to dry, preferably in sunlight Hang any fur or leather goods to dry at room temperature Punch small holes in sagging ceilings to relieve trapped water (don't forget to place pans beneath!); however, if the ceiling is sagging extremely low, stay out of the room and we'll take care of it DO NOT:
Leave wet fabrics in place; dry them as soon as possible Leave books, magazines or any other colored items on wet carpets or floor Use your household vacuum to remove water Use TV's or other electronics/appliances while standing on wet carpets or floors; especially not on wet concrete floors Turn on ceiling fixtures if the ceiling is wet Turn your heat up, unless instructed otherwise
